Listen to Your Target Audience

Before you launch into a blitz of posts or sharing content, spend the time to find out what your target audience is already doing. Determine what kind of content they are engaging with or the things target businesses or buyers are posting.

This sets a baseline for the content your prospective buyer would both notice and take interest in. Check out competitors’ pages to see what their content focuses on.

Don’t Limit Your Content

Too many businesses feel they need to be completely original to attract attention. While it is important to be a fresh voice on the B2B manufacturing scene, consider the benefit of sharing existing information relevant to the industry and your target audience.

You could share legislation changes, supply chain information, current event articles, or interviews with leaders in the field. When you branch out with your content marketing, you develop a stronger reputation in the industry.

Take Advantage of Influencers

It’s easy for a manufacturing company to appear faceless and impersonal outside of the occasional trade show event. By connecting with social media influencers, you can give your brand a better visual and differentiate yourself from the competition.

B2B influencer marketing is definitely a new concept, but it has the potential to bring significant value. Finding a celebrity or other well-received individual to endorse your brand through a product review video can grow your brand awareness by millions of views.

Practical Ideas for Posting on Social Media for Manufacturers

There are plenty of ways to share your manufacturing business online. Rather than trying all of them, it’s important to craft a strategy that fits your business objectives and addresses the needs of your target audience. Here are three creative ways to get started.

Share Quality Photos of Your Products

Customers want to see exactly what they’re getting, and a picture is worth a thousand words. Sharing high-quality photos is a great way to show off complex machinery, custom-made parts, or your products in action.

You have plenty of options when it comes to images. You can share pictures of specific parts, products throughout the manufacturing stages, other versions or models, your factory, and much more.

You can also use images to make an important event or date stand out. Graphics can highlight details without taking up a lot of space.

Live Stream Important or Engaging Content

Live streaming is incredibly popular among consumers, with people often preferring to watch a live stream instead of video-on-demand or reading a blog post. You can live stream a Q&A about your company or products, give away a special deal or price, or present a preview of an upcoming event.

Live streams are a way to stay connected with both current and potential customers. However, consistency is paramount when working with live video content.

Introduce and Recognize Your Team

The inner workings of your company are important to your customers, and you can use team-focused posts on social media for manufacturers to highlight your staff. Employees are the heart and soul behind your company, bringing quality products and services to your customers. Use blog posts or photos to give them recognition or to share promotions and advancements.

Including employee achievements and upgrades will help humanize your company. It puts additional faces on the brand and makes your business relatable. It also demonstrates that your company values its team members and cares about their contributions.
